CVE-2021-23921
published 2021-04-01CVE-2021-23921: An issue was discovered in Devolutions Server before 2020.3. There is broken access control on Password List entry elements.

An issue was discovered in Devolutions Server before 2020.3. There is broken access control on Password List entry elements.
Affected
1 ranges
| Vendor | Product | Version range | Fixed in |
|---|---|---|---|
| devolutions | devolutions_server | < 2020.3 | 2020.3 |
CVSS provenance
nvdv3.19.1CRITICALCV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N
nvdv2.06.4MEDIUMAV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:N
